In the realm of ad design in Zhejiang Province, scoped innovation and sustainable innovation play pivotal roles. Scoped innovation involves tailoring advertising strategies to target specific audiences or product segments, such as emphasizing brand positioning or leveraging unique design elements. Sustainable innovation, on the other hand, prioritizes environmental and social impact, using eco-friendly materials, reducing energy consumption, and fostering sustainability in brand communication. In Zhejiang Province, these innovations are likely implemented through tailored marketing approaches, such as digital ads targeting urban professionals or environmental messaging that resonates with the local community. By integrating scoped innovation and sustainable innovation, Zhejiang Province's advertising strategies aim to enhance both market competitiveness and environmental responsibility, ensuring a balanced and sustainable public image.
